Re Kidney problems
My ultrasound was normal and my urine tests have had blood in them for almost a year... the doctor said it was Plus one or one plus.. i cant remember which... the pain in my back seems to get worse when there is more blood present.
the did a number of blood tests on me including a kidney function test which was normal and an insulin test which showed alot of insulin in my blood.. the doctor says im insulin resitant.
my urologist did a urine test on monday but i had already started to take the anti biotics my doctor gave me for the infection so by then there was no sign of infection.. just the blood.. so he couldnt culture anything... he did a blood test on me to see y ive started to shake and im supposed to get the results today.
Ive been poked and proded at since my first major kidney infection when i was still in high school.. at one point they even sent me to a rhuematic specialist (due to the swelling which i was hospitalised for but signed my self out of a week later as all they did for me was cover me in ice packs and give me coretsone they eventually labeled it Vasculitis.. then changed there mind and said it was Nephritis)
they seem to be passing me around and i really just want to know what the problem is so that it can be fixed.. im only 20 but i feel like im 90!

Sara, it sounds like it might be due to some sort of auto-immune disorder – in other words your body attacks your kidneys for some reason or the other. This might be very dangerous as it may cause permanent kidney damaged if it isn’t controlled. You might need a kidney biopsy to prove the diagnosis, but before you have that done you should get a second opinion from a different urologist. Good luck.
